Explanatory Cognitive Diagnosis Models Incorporating Item Features.

Manqian Liao1, Hong Jiao2, Qiwei He3

  • 1Duolingo, Inc., 5900 Penn Ave, Pittsburgh, PA 15206, USA.

Journal of Intelligence
|March 27, 2024
PubMed
Summary

This study introduces item explanatory cognitive diagnosis models (CDMs) to improve item quality assessment. By linking item parameters to linguistic features, these models offer better insights for enhancing test items.

Area of Science:

  • Psychometrics
  • Educational Measurement
  • Cognitive Diagnosis

Background:

  • Item quality is vital for accurate psychometric analyses in cognitive diagnosis.
  • Traditional cognitive diagnosis models (CDMs) use item response data alone, complicating the identification and improvement of low-quality items.
  • Challenges include pinpointing issues like high guessing probabilities or difficulty in improving item quality.

Purpose of the Study:

  • To propose item explanatory CDMs that integrate item features with item parameters.
  • To leverage item features as an additional information source for calibrating CDM parameters.
  • To enhance the understanding and improvement of item quality in cognitive diagnosis.

Main Methods:

  • Developed item explanatory cognitive diagnosis models (CDMs).
  • Extracted approximately 20 linguistic features from item stems using natural language processing techniques.
  • Applied the models to Trends in International Mathematics and Science Study (TIMSS) data, analyzing relationships between item parameters and features using a higher-order DINA model.

Main Results:

  • Demonstrated the utility of item explanatory CDMs with real-world data.
  • Identified relationships between guessing/slipping parameters and specific item features.
  • A simulation study corroborated the findings from the empirical data analysis.

Conclusions:

  • Item explanatory CDMs provide a valuable framework for understanding and improving item quality.
  • Integrating item features offers a richer approach to psychometric analysis than relying solely on response data.
  • This approach facilitates targeted item development and refinement for better diagnostic assessments.
